Determination of the components in the Sanye Health Cigarette by HPLC

Abstract: Objective: To establish the HPLC method for determination of the major components (campherol, isorhamnetin, meletin and betaine) in the Sanye Health Cigarette. Methods: Campherol, isorhmnetin and meletin were separated by a Hypersil-C18 column (250mm×4.6mm, 5μm), and eluted by mobile phase of methanol-0.4% phosphoric acid (60∶40,V∶V) and detected at wave length of 360nm and flow rate of 1.2ml·min-1. Betaine was separated by a HypersilC18 column(250mm×4.6mm, 5μm), eluted by mobile phase of 50mM potassium dihydrogen phosphate(pH4.45, containing 0.3% sodium 1octane sulfonate) and detected at wave length of 200?nm and flow rate of 0.7ml·min-1. Results: Fairly good linearity for campherol, isorhamnetin, meletin and betaine was obtained in the ranges of 0.2-4.8μg·ml-1, 0.1-2.4μg·ml-1, 0.025-0.8μg·ml-1, and 1.0-32.0μg·ml-1. The method precisions were 1.5%, 2.1%, 1.6% and 2.2%, respectively, and their amounts (%) in the Sanye Health Cigarette were 0.00242, 0.000849, 0.000249 and 0.00636, respectively. Conclusion: The method is simple, convenient, rapid and accurate, and can be used for the determination of the major components in the Sanye Health Cigarette.
